We are seeking a compassionate and detail-oriented Registered Nurse (RN) to join our Ambulatory Surgery Center (ASC) team. This role provides comprehensive perioperative nursing care across pre-operative, intra-operative, and post-anesthesia recovery (PACU) settings and also serves as the facility’s Safety Officer, supporting compliance with AAAHC standards. The ideal candidate is collaborative, organized, and committed to patient safety and continuous quality improvement. 

This is a part-time role totaling 24 hours per month, including clinical and administrative responsibilities. 

Schedule & Hours 

  • 2 clinical days per month in the surgery center: 
    • 1 Local Anesthesia Days 
    • 1 IV Sedation Days 
  • Administrative Time: 
    • 1 day (8 hours) per month dedicated to administrative/Safety Officer duties

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ide perioperative nursing care including pre-op assessments, circulating support during procedures, and PACU recovery
  • Verify patient histories, consents, and required documentation
  • Monitor patient condition, vital signs, pain levels, and recovery progress
  • Educate patients and families on post-operative care, medications, and discharge instructions
  • Accurately document all nursing care in the electronic health record

Safety Officer & Compliance Duties

  • Serve as the designated Safety Officer for the facility
  • Support compliance with AAAHC standards related to patient safety, infection prevention, emergency preparedness, and risk management
  • Conduct and document safety rounds, drills, and risk assessments
  • Review incident reports and support quality improvement initiatives
  • Participate in Quality Assessment and Performance Improvement (QAPI) activities
  • Maintain audit-ready safety logs and regulatory documentation
  • Assist with staff education on safety policies and emergency protocols
